a hump day thought and observation:
We are all in a fairly long lead time business, where some of us have many months to even years back log.
Even realizing that once the queue hits some of us spend less than a day on completing said order, I am still perplexed how many people order parts from me at the last minute.
I am not complaining, and am almost always able to oblige. I pride myself on my ability to turn around orders very fast.
Having a job shop as well means that tight deadlines are the normal...
I also realize that budgets are tight and we don't want to sit on a bunch of inventory if we can help it.
I am also guilty of forgetting to order something or not getting enough, ect... sure, there is always a need for next day air, right?!
But if the majority of orders are rush orders, some needing expensive shipping, isn't the money spent on expensive shipping outweighing the money saved by not tying up your money in inventory?
Again- not complaining or implying anything- Just a trend I have noticed.
